A member asked:

After leukemia treatment what normal range white blood cell count?

A doctor has provided 1 answer

4,000-10,000: The normal range for WBC is 4, 000 - 10, 000. Sometimes, depending on the type of leukemia and treatment given, the WBC might be lower than the normal range as a side effect of the treatment. To be a remission, there must not be any abnormal cells in the blood or bone marrow.
